InfiniLink lands $10mn seed round to advance optical communication chips

Cairo – Sharikat Mubasher: Egyptian semiconductor startup InfiniLink raised $10 million in seed funding, a milestone that underscores investor confidence in its mission to revolutionize optical communication for AI-driven data centers.

According to a recent press release, the funding round was spearheaded by global semiconductor leader MediaTek, with participation from Sukna Ventures, Egypt Ventures, and angel investment firm M Empire Angels.

This backing strengthens InfiniLink’s capacity to refine its cutting-edge technologies and expand into new markets.

InfiniLink is transforming data center communications with its mixed-signal analog and photonics-based solutions, designed to enhance efficiency while cutting energy consumption. At the heart of its innovation is the Integrated Optical Transceiver Chip (iOTC) for silicon photonics, enabling ultra-fast data transmission with minimal signal loss. As AI and cloud computing drive unprecedented data demands, InfiniLink’s breakthrough technology addresses the need for high-speed, energy-efficient communication systems.

The fresh capital will accelerate R&D efforts, production scaling, and global market expansion, while also helping the company attract top engineering talent and forge strategic partnerships in the semiconductor and optical communication sectors.

Founded in 2022, InfiniLink is on a mission to establish Egypt as a leader in semiconductor innovation. With surging global demand for advanced optical communication, this investment brings the company closer to positioning Egypt as a regional hub for next-generation technology. By leveraging its expertise and pioneering solutions, InfiniLink is set to play a critical role in shaping the future of AI-powered data centers worldwide.
